Baillie - Watchmakers & Clockmakers of the World - Volume 1


Baillie, G. H. Watchmakers & Clockmakers of the World. Volume 1
London: N.A.G. Press
ISBN 7198 0004 4.

This comprehensive reference work lists over 36,000 watchmakers from all over the world.
In addition to names, places and dates, it contains abbreviations, alternative spellings, initials and monograms as well as references to museums and collections. Maps for geographical categorisation complete the work.
It is based on meticulous archival studies, including the holdings of the Worshipful Company of Clockmakers (from 1632) and other European archives. Baillie draws on his own research and the work of numerous specialist colleagues to create an internationally recognised reference work for collectors, historians and museums.
